The 2018 Pieve di Soligo Friendly was held on July 14 in Pieve di Soligo, Italy.
All-Around Results
Rank | Athlete | Nation | VT | UB | BB | FX | AA |
1 | Elisa Iorio | Italy | 14.450 | 14.400 | 13.300 | 13.450 | 55.600 |
2 | Giorgia Villa | Italy | 14.750 | 14.050 | 13.000 | 13.650 | 55.450 |
3 | Carolann Heduit | France | 14.100 | 13.600 | 13.300 | 12.800 | 53.800 |
4 | Claire Pontlevoy | France | 13.800 | 12.850 | 13.200 | 12.950 | 52.800 |

6 | Alizée Letrange-Mouakit | France | 13.650 | 12.350 | 13.250 | 12.500 | 51.750 |
7 | Camilla Campagnaro | Italy | 14.250 | 12.300 | 12.200 | 12.600 | 51.350 |
8 | Amelie Morgan | Great Britain | 14.350 | 13.350 | 12.250 | 11.300 | 51.250 |
9 | Mathilde Wahl | France | 13.400 | 12.700 | 12.050 | 13.050 | 51.200 |
10 | Emelie Petz | Germany | 11.950 | 13.900 | 12.100 | 13.150 | 51.100 |
11 | Ondine Achampong | Great Britain | 13.450 | 12.000 | 12.800 | 12.600 | 50.850 |
12 | Annie Young | Great Britain | 13.450 | 13.350 | 12.350 | 10.650 | 49.800 |
13 | Emma Malewski | Germany | 12.550 | 12.100 | 12.950 | 12.150 | 49.750 |
14 | Lara Hinsberger | Germany | 13.650 | 12.350 | 11.450 | 12.250 | 49.700 |
15 | Lena Bickel | Switzerland | 13.400 | 12.500 | 12.100 | 11.400 | 49.400 |
16 | Aline Friess | France | 12.850 | 11.950 | 12.050 | 12.450 | 49.300 |
17 | Phoebe Jakubczyk | Great Britain | 13.250 | 12.850 | 11.300 | 11.650 | 49.050 |
18 | Nina Ferrazzini | Switzerland | 13.600 | 11.200 | 12.150 | 12.050 | 49.000 |
19 | Leonie Papke | Germany | 13.050 | 12.150 | 12.350 | 10.600 | 48.150 |
20 | Lisa Zimmermann | Germany | 13.500 | 10.850 | 12.000 | 11.150 | 47.500 |
21 | Anastassia Pascu | Switzerland | 13.200 | 11.550 | 11.700 | 10.400 | 46.850 |
22 | Lou Steffen | Switzerland | 11.750 | 12.350 | 10.100 | 12.150 | 46.350 |
23 | Aiyu Zhu | Germany | 13.550 | 8.850 | 10.000 | 11.900 | 44.300 |
24 | Alice D’Amato | Italy | 13.550 | 13.900 | 12.900 | —— | 40.350 |
25 | Halle Hilton | Great Britain | 11.900 | —— | 13.350 | 12.150 | 37.400 |
26 | Giulia Cotroneo | Italy | —— | 11.850 | 11.550 | 12.050 | 35.450 |
27 | Alessia Gresser | Switzerland | 13.500 | —— | 10.200 | 11.400 | 35.100 |
28 | Agathe Germann | Switzerland | —— | 10.150 | 10.000 | 10.200 | 30.350 |
29 | Alessia Federici | Italy | —— | 12.500 | 12.650 | —— | 25.150 |
30 | Leah Greenland | Great Britain | —— | —— | 11.350 | 12.000 | 23.350 |
Team Results
Rank | Nation | VT | UB | BB | FX | AA |
1 | ITALYÂ (Camilla Campagnaro, Giulia Cotroneo, Alice D’Amato, Alessia Federici, Elisa Iorio, Giorgia Villa) | 43.450 | 42.350 | 39.200 | 39.700 | 164.700 |
2 | FRANCE (Julia Forestier, Aline Friess, Carolann Heduit, Alizée Letrange-Mouakit, Claire Pontlevoy, Mathilde Wahl) | 41.550 | 39.150 | 40.550 | 38.800 | 160.050 |
3 | GREAT BRITAINÂ (Ondine Achampong, Leah Greenland, Halle Hilton, Phoebe Jakubczyk, Amelie Morgan, Annie Young) | 41.250 | 39.550 | 38.500 | 36.750 | 156.050 |
4 | GERMANYÂ (Lara Hinsberger, Emma Malewski, Leonie Papke, Emelie Petz, Aiyu Zhu, Lisa Zimmermann) | 40.700 | 38.400 | 37.400 | 37.550 | 154.050 |
5 | SWITZERLANDÂ (Lena Bickel, Nina Ferrazzini, Agathe Germann, Alessia Gresser, Anastassia Pascu, Lou Steffen) | 40.500 | 36.400 | 35.950 | 35.600 | 148.450 |
